Earnings for Precision Production Graduates from Linn-Benton Community College
Graduates of Linn-Benton Community College’s Precision Production program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 1 year | $38,567 |
| 2 years | $42,123 |
| 3 years | $43,484 |
| 4 years | $46,957 |
| 5 years | $51,995 |
How do these earnings stack up against the rest of the school? Four years out, Precision Production graduates from Linn-Benton Community College report median earnings of $46,957, compared with $41,356 for all Linn-Benton Community College graduates — about 14% higher than the school-wide median.
Top-Paying Careers for Precision Production Graduates
Graduates of the Precision Production program at Linn-Benton Community College pursue many career paths. The table below ranks the top-paying careers for Precision Production majors, ordered by median annual salary:
| Occupation | Nationwide Median Wage |
|---|---|
| Boilermakers | $84,334 |
| Patternmakers, Wood | $69,107 |
| Foundry Mold and Coremakers | $69,095 |
| Metal Workers and Plastic Workers, All Other | $67,669 |
| Extruding and Drawing Machine Setters, Operators, and Tenders, Metal and Plastic | $67,252 |
| Cabinetmakers and Bench Carpenters | $67,016 |
| Sheet Metal Workers | $62,339 |
| Computer Numerically Controlled Tool Programmers | $60,584 |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| $60,230 |
| Machinists | $58,269 |
